Default Front axle upgrade

Alright so the end of this month I am going to get my stock 44 axle strengthened. I'm going to get the sleeve and gussets done, but what I'm wondering is should I also get the chromoly shafts also? I don't plan on going any larger then my 35's for a while but I do like to wheel especially in the rocks. Just looking for opinions see what you guys and gals think? Thanks

if it were me, i would get chromoly shaft with full circle clips way before i'd spend any money on sleeves. c-gussets are a must though. i know they're all the rage and all the fanboys will come out and say you should get rcv's but really, there's no need to spend so much more money for something you really don't need.
